Transaction 945081cf5e439f58580696dd7e21e1e672ad4a948578f39f3d74bddf72ad4b3e

2 Input
2 Outputs
  • 945081cf5e439f58580696dd7e21e1e672ad4a948578f39f3d74bddf72ad4b3e:0
  • value  10223770000
    address  1KUFa2axVWVNUipMEtBNNhDLoDDn2sg4QH
  • 945081cf5e439f58580696dd7e21e1e672ad4a948578f39f3d74bddf72ad4b3e:1
  • value  466768358
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P